gcc/
* config/mips/mips.c (mips_expand_block_move): Enable inline memcpy expansion when !ISA_HAS_LWL_LWR. (mips_block_move_straight): Update the size of elements copied to account for alignment when !ISA_HAS_LWL_LWR. * config/mips/mips.h (MIPS_MIN_MOVE_MEM_ALIGN): New macro. gcc/testsuite/ * inline-memcpy-1.c: Test for inline expansion of memcpy. * inline-memcpy-2.c: Ditto. * inline-memcpy-3.c: Ditto. * inline-memcpy-4.c: Ditto. * inline-memcpy-5.c: Ditto. git-svn-id: svn+ssh://gcc.gnu.org/svn/gcc/trunk@227026 138bc75d-0d04-0410-961f-82ee72b054a4

diff --git a/gcc/config/mips/mips.c b/gcc/config/mips/mips.c
index 401d73bfeaa..0b4a5faacdb 100644
--- a/gcc/config/mips/mips.c
+++ b/gcc/config/mips/mips.c
@@ -7630,12 +7630,22 @@ mips_block_move_straight (rtx dest, rtx src, HOST_WIDE_INT length)
half-word alignment, it is usually better to move in half words.
For instance, lh/lh/sh/sh is usually better than lwl/lwr/swl/swr
and lw/lw/sw/sw is usually better than ldl/ldr/sdl/sdr.
- Otherwise move word-sized chunks. */
- if (MEM_ALIGN (src) == BITS_PER_WORD / 2
- && MEM_ALIGN (dest) == BITS_PER_WORD / 2)
- bits = BITS_PER_WORD / 2;
+ Otherwise move word-sized chunks.
+
+ For ISA_HAS_LWL_LWR we rely on the lwl/lwr & swl/swr load. Otherwise
+ picking the minimum of alignment or BITS_PER_WORD gets us the
+ desired size for bits. */
+
+ if (!ISA_HAS_LWL_LWR)
+ bits = MIN (BITS_PER_WORD, MIN (MEM_ALIGN (src), MEM_ALIGN (dest)));
else
- bits = BITS_PER_WORD;
+ {
+ if (MEM_ALIGN (src) == BITS_PER_WORD / 2
+ && MEM_ALIGN (dest) == BITS_PER_WORD / 2)
+ bits = BITS_PER_WORD / 2;
+ else
+ bits = BITS_PER_WORD;
+ }
mode = mode_for_size (bits, MODE_INT, 0);
delta = bits / BITS_PER_UNIT;
@@ -7754,8 +7764,9 @@ mips_block_move_loop (rtx dest, rtx src, HOST_WIDE_INT length,
bool
mips_expand_block_move (rtx dest, rtx src, rtx length)
{
- /* Disable entirely for R6 initially. */
- if (!ISA_HAS_LWL_LWR)
+ if (!ISA_HAS_LWL_LWR
+ && (MEM_ALIGN (src) < MIPS_MIN_MOVE_MEM_ALIGN
+ || MEM_ALIGN (dest) < MIPS_MIN_MOVE_MEM_ALIGN))
return false;
if (CONST_INT_P (length))
